Design features and model range Yamaha 5 hp
Yamaha's engineering philosophy is based on reliability and ease of service. In the 5 horsepower class, the company offers solutions in both two-stroke (2T) and four-stroke (4T) versions. 2MHSThey are very lightweight and high power density, and they're ideal for lightweight inflatable boats, where every kilogram per transom is important.
Four-stroke versions, for example, series F5They're more modern units, they're heavier, quieter and more economical. The 4T design involves a separate lubrication system, which eliminates the need to mix gasoline with oil. Motor resource Four-stroke engines are usually higher and vibrations are minimized thanks to a more complex crank-shaking mechanism.
β οΈ Warning: When buying a used motor, be sure to check the condition of the lower unit. If the anti-cavitational raft shows deep scratches or dents, this may indicate impacts on underwater obstacles, which can lead to cracks in the gearbox body.
An important element of the design is the ignition system. Current Yamaha models use an electronic system CDI (Capacitor Discharge Ignition), which provides a stable spark at any speed and does not require adjustment of the gap of candles during operation, and it is worth noting the presence of a forced water cooling system with a control jet, which allows you to visually evaluate the pump.
The Hidden specifications of lower unit
Inside the lower unit, there are shafts that transmit torque from the engine to the propeller. 5 hp models often use a single shaft, which simplifies the design, but requires high-quality lubrication of bearings. The lubrication in the gearbox changes annually or every 100 motor hours.
Comparison of two-stroke and four-stroke versions
Choosing between the 2T and the 4T is a perpetual dilemma for the water-engineer: Yamahaβs 5hp twin-stroke engines are attractive in their compactness and price; they are lighter than four-stroke engines by about 30 to 40 percent, which is critical when carrying equipment to the descent site; however, they require a fuel mix and emit higher noise levels.
Four-stroke engines benefit from environmental friendliness and comfort. The lack of smoke and the smell of burnt oil makes fishing more enjoyable, especially if you are in a confined boat space. The 4T has a fuel consumption that is about 20-30% lower at the same load, allowing you to take fewer canisters of gasoline on long journeys.
- π Dynamics: The 2T is faster for planing with full load due to high torque at low revs.
- π Noise: The 4Ts are much quieter, which is important for camouflage when fishing.
- π οΈ Maintenance: The 2T is easier to repair, the 4T requires regular engine oil and oil filter replacement.
- βοΈ Weight: The 2T is lighter, which is important for small boats where the shifting of the center of gravity affects driving performance.
The temperature of the engine is also important to consider: Yamaha four-stroke engines are equipped with a thermostat that maintains the optimum engine temperature, which allows the engine to operate in the most efficient mode, but requires careful attention to the cooling system to avoid overheating when driving at low speeds.

Rules of running and first start
From how the break-in goes. pit-motor 5It depends on up to 50 percent of its future life. The process of grinding rubbing parts requires strict adherence to instructions. For two-stroke engines, it is critical to prepare the fuel mixture correctly. Use only special oils for water equipment labeled TC-W3.
The first start is better done on the shore in a tank of water or on a special βflaskβ to make sure that there is a control jet of cooling. The absence of a jet even for 30 seconds can lead to bullies of the piston group. The break-in mode is usually 10 hours, during which it is not recommended to open the throttle more than 50-70%.
βοΈ Checklist before first launch
β οΈ Warning: Never start a motor without being submerged in water or connected to a water pipe with sufficient pressure. Dry running of a water pump instantly disables the impeller and sealing omentals.
After the first 10 hours of operation, the oil in the gearbox (for all types of motors) should be replaced and, in the case of a four-stroke, the engine oil should be replaced, which will remove the products of the initial grinding of metal parts from the lubrication system.
Typical malfunctions and methods of their elimination
Despite the high reliability of Yamaha equipment, there can be problems in operation, most often related to fuel quality or operating regulations, one of the common problems is difficult to start, the reasons can be due to clogging of the carburetor's jellybars, a malfunction of the spark plug or water entering the fuel tank.
If the engine is dead at high speeds, there may be a fuel supply problem or there is an air suction in the fuel system, it is also worth checking the condition of the fuel filter-sludge, in four-stroke engines, the cause of power loss can be pollution of the air filter or the need to replace candles.
- π₯ Overheating: Often caused by a clogged water intake hole by algae or sand.
- π¨ Smoke: For 2T, it is a sign of a rich mixture or old oil; for 4T, it is a sign of oil entering the combustion chamber (wear and tear of the rings).
- π Knock: May indicate problems with bearings of the crankshaft or rod, requires immediate diagnosis.
To diagnose the condition of the engine, you can use the compressometry method. Normal compression for Yamaha 5 hp engines should be in the range of 9-12 kg / cm2. Significant differences between cylinders (in multi-cylinder models) or low readings indicate wear of the piston group.
Regular replacement of fuel filters and use of high-quality fuel and lubricants prevents 90% of possible breakdowns of the fuel system and engine.
Tips for Winter Storage and Conservation
The key to keeping the engine properly preserved before winter is to start in the spring, and the main objective is to protect the internal cavities from corrosion and prevent rubber seals from drying out, first of all, to drain the water completely from the cooling system, and to do this, the motor is installed vertically and drains the remaining water.
The fuel system is recommended to be developed dry or preserved with a special fuel stabilizer. The gasoline left for the winter in the carburetor is oxidized and forms a resinous plaque that clogs the thinnest channels of jelly-cutters. It is also useful to lubricate the outer metal surfaces with special preservative lubrication.
Store the motor in a vertical position in a dry, ventilated room. It is not recommended to cover the engine with a dense plastic film, as this creates a greenhouse effect and contributes to the development of corrosion. It is better to use special breathable covers or fabric capes.

Do I need to register the 5 hp engine in GIMS?
According to the current legislation of the Russian Federation, registration is subject to small vessels with a weight of up to 200 kg inclusive and engine power up to 8 kW (about 10.88 hp) inclusive. Thus, the bundle "boat + engine 5 hp" most often does not require registration if the total weight of the equipped vessel does not exceed 200 kg. However, the rules may change, and it is always worth checking the current information at the local branch of the GIMS.
what oil to use in the Yamaha 5 hp gearbox?
The gearbox is filled with a special transmission oil for outboard motors (usually the viscosity class SAE 90 or 80W-90). It is important that the oil has a label indicating suitability for operation in an aqueous environment (protection against emulsification). The volume of oil in the Yamaha 5 hp gearbox is usually about 150-200 ml, but the exact volume is better specified in the manual of a particular model.
Why doesn't the engine keep idling?
Unstable idling is most often caused by sucking unaccounted air through the carburetor gaskets, clogging of the idling channels or improper adjustment of the screw quality of the mixture. It is also worth checking the state of the spark plug and the angle of ignition advance.
